Abstract

This visit aims develop and implement in Brazil a relatively new research methodology for studying some of the fundamental economic forces influencing the growth of Brazilian agriculture, and the sector linkages with the rest of the Brazilian economy. Using a dynamic growth model, we will compare per capita GDP series under a no global warming model (the base) with the per capital GDP series under several global warming scenarios, calculate the discounted present value of the difference in per capital GDP under the base model and the global warming models, and examine the potential impact of global warming on agricultural growth in Brazil.
